How Hamburger Bun Calories Actually Works

At its core, the calorie content of a hamburger bun is relatively straightforward. A standard hamburger bun typically ranges from 100 to 120 calories, depending on the type and size. However, the real challenge lies in the intricacies of carbohydrate composition and the role of added sugars, preservatives, and other ingredients. Understanding the nutritional breakdown of a hamburger bun requires a basic knowledge of macronutrients and the factors that influence calorie density.

Things People Often Misunderstand

  • Myth: All hamburger buns are equally caloric. While some buns may be lower in calories, others can be significantly higher.* Myth: Hamburger buns are the primary contributor to calorie intake in a meal. The patty, toppings, and condiments often play a more significant role.* Myth: Choosing a whole-grain bun automatically makes it a healthy option. While whole-grain buns can be a better choice, added sugars, preservatives, and other ingredients can still affect the nutritional profile.
